All Grown Up
Written byDeclan MacManus
Performed byElvis Costello
Produced byMitchell Froom, Kevin Killen & D.P.A. MacManus
MusiciansElvis Costello - vocals
Jim Keltner - drums
T-Bone Wolk - bass
Larry Knechtel - piano, Clavinet
James Burton - acoustic guitar
Marc Ribot - cornet, Eb horn
Mitchell Froom - Chamberlain, portative organ
Gavyn Wright - string leader
Fiachra Trench - orchestra conductor, string & woodwind arrangement
Recordedlate 1990-early 1991, Ocean Way, Hollywood & Westside Studios, London
ReleasedMay 10, 1991
AlbumsMighty Like A Rose, 1991
Length4:14

First known performance:
May 25, 1991, Santa Barbara, CA
Last known performance:
June 6, 2015, Harrogate, England
     (23 known performances)
